Making online payments simple

Senior Java/Kotlin Engineer (Core)


Our Mission and Vision

At Solidgate, our mission is clear: to empower outstanding entrepreneurs to build exceptional internet companies. We exist to fuel the builders â€” the ones shaping the digital economy â€” with the financial infrastructure they deserve.

Key facts:

—Offices in Ukraine, Poland, and Cyprus
—250+ team members
—200+ clients went global (Ukraine, US, EU)
—Visa and Mastercard Principal Membership
—EMI license in the EU
 

Solidgate is part of Endeavor â€” a global community of the world’s most impactful entrepreneurs. We’re proud to be the first payment orchestrator from Europe to join â€” and to share our expertise within a network of outstanding global companies.

We believe the future of payments is shaped by people who think big, take ownership, and bring curiosity and drive to everything they do. That’s exactly the kind of teammates we want on board.

Our advantages:

—A product with impact: Work on a product with a powerful backend architecture, complex business logic, and a modern tech stack
—A strong engineering culture: Our engineers don’t just maintain systems; they design them from the ground up
—Rapid growth: You’ll be part of a fast-scaling product, creating features that solve real business challenges
—Meaningful challenges: Tackle complex problems and see your direct impact on the company’s growth
—An A-player team: Join a team that is passionate about a common goal, united by a shared vision and values.

We’re on the lookout for a motivated and decisive Java/Kotlin Engineer to join the Core Team. You’ll have a unique chance to boost our team both in terms of capacity and quality, and make a real impact on a product currently in active development.

Our Tech Stack: Kotlin (K/JVM), Spring Boot, PostgreSQL, Hibernate, Elastic, RabbitMQ, AWS, Docker, GitLab.


Your Role:
 

—Develop key features like payment routing between providers, 3DS payment processing, payment synchronization solutions, BIN services, and asynchronous financial reporting
—Participate in designing new payment architecture
—Find robust architectural solutions for processing financial transactions within our product ecosystem
—Work on the reliability of the entire payment system
—Take ownership of critical services
—Write unit and functional tests to ensure top-notch quality


What You Need:
 

—5+ years of experience with Kotlin (K/JVM) or Java
—Knowledge of PostgreSQL or MySQL
—Experience with Spring Boot and Spring Framework
—Background in working with large systems and complex databases
—Experience with microservices architecture
—Proactive attitude and results-oriented approach
—Understanding of business processes


Bonus Points:
 

—Experience with RabbitMQ
—Knowledge of Apache Kafka
—Familiarity with GRPC
—Experience with Golang
—Background in fintech or financial sectors

At Solidgate, you’ll work on an intriguing and challenging product, contribute to building its architecture, and have a real impact on our company’s future! Join us and make a difference!


Competitive corporate benefits:
 

—more than 30 days off during the year (20 working days of vacation + days off for national holidays)
—health insurance and corporate doctor
—free snacks, breakfasts, and lunches in the office
—full coverage of professional training (courses, conferences, certifications)
—annual performance review
—sports compensation
—competitive salary
—the ability to work remotely
—Apple equipment

đź“© Ready to become a part of the team? Then cast aside all doubts and click “apply”.

 

Required languages

English B1 - Intermediate
Java/Kotlin, KotIin, SQL, AWS, PostgreSQL, REST API
Published 20 August
72 views
·
4 applications
To apply for this and other jobs on Djinni login or signup.
Loading...